Output 003661a22f959444dd62e63131562a1d990ee91d0ed6d97f160e8eda8529bd31:10

value
17313
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fba2e61767e1aa75896c795bd0cb6f59f62225d8260be6a5820bf34ff28c1b17
address
bc1plw3wv9m8ux48tztv09dapjm0t8mzyfwcyc97dfvzp0e5lu5vrvts4met6c
transaction
003661a22f959444dd62e63131562a1d990ee91d0ed6d97f160e8eda8529bd31
spent
true